嵌入式数据终端平台的研制

【作者】 何娜琴

【导师】 陆宝春;

【作者基本信息】 南京理工大学 , 机械电子工程, 2007, 硕士

【摘要】 随着嵌入式系统硬件设备的广泛运用、价格不断降低,及嵌入式系统应用范围的不断扩大,嵌入式文件系统的重要性显得更加突出。嵌入式系统通常是无磁盘系统,为了让嵌入式系统能够永久性保存资料,使用闪存是一种普遍的策略。那么如何在嵌入式系统环境中建立闪存文件系统就成为了本文研究和解决的重要问题。嵌入式数据终端平台是针对江苏光一科技公司现有自动抄表产品的技术不足,而设计开发的智能抄表新平台。该平台以LPC2292处理器为核心,移植了μC/OS-Ⅱ操作系统,外加各存储模块、通信模块等。论文基于对该平台实际应用的需求分析,通过对文件系统的分析研究,并结合嵌入式闪存文件系统的设计特点,构建了一兼容FAT文件系统的嵌入式NAND Flash文件系统,与此同时,通过USB总线,实现了PC机和嵌入式数据终端平台间的通信,完成了两者间文件的上下传输。系统的调试与测试表明:系统达到了预期的功能要求及一定的性能要求,实现了课题研究的预期目标。

【Abstract】 With the increasing of availability of embedded system hardware and the lowering ofits price, and the expanding of application field, the importance of embedded file system isbecoming more and more significant.Embedded systems are usually diskless systems. In order to keep permanent data inthe systems, it is a widely adapted strategy to use flash memory. Therefore how to build aflash file system in embedded system is the focus of this thesis.The Embedded Development Platform of Data Terminal is a new intelligent meterreading platform which is designed for Jiangsu Elefirst Technology Company, based on thepurpose to solve some disadvantages of the existing meter reading system. The platform isbased on LPC2292 microprocessor andμC/OS-Ⅱoperating system. It also includes somemodules such as memory modules, communication modules and so on. On the basis of thedemand analysis of the products and the research of file system, combined with thecharacteristic of the design of embedded flash file system, an embedded NAND Flash filesystem based on FAT structure is built on the platform. At the same time thecommunication between Personal Computer and the terminal platform through UniversalSerial Bus is completed. Files can be transferred between the two.Through the debugging and testing of the system it is proved that the system reachesthe function and performance demand as expected, and achieves the anticipated target ofthe research.
